• Unpack all the parts and identify them against the fittings and components lists.
• Do not discard any packaging until you are sure you have all the components and the pack of fittings.
• Read the instructions thoroughly before attempting to construct the cot.
• You may find the construction of your cot easier if you have the help of another person.
• Follow each stage of the construction step-by-step.
